Addressed Issues:

Fixes #68

  • Added MAX_ENDORSEMENTS = 100 in src/IdentityToken.sol.
  • Added a guard in endorse() to revert with Errors.IndexOutOfBounds() when the cap is reached.
  • Added test_RevertIf_MaxEndorsementsReached() in test/IdentityToken.t.sol to verify the 101st endorsement reverts.

Walkthrough

The changes implement a maximum endorsement limit by introducing a public constant MAX_ENDORSEMENTS = 100 to the IdentityToken contract and enforcing this cap in the endorse() function, which reverts with Errors.IndexOutOfBounds() when the limit is reached. A corresponding test validates this enforcement.

🧹 Nitpick | 🔵 Trivial

Avoid hardcoded cap values in the boundary test.

Use identityToken.MAX_ENDORSEMENTS() to keep the test aligned if the cap changes.

♻️ Suggested test update
-        for (uint256 i = 0; i < 100; i++) {
+        uint256 maxEndorsements = identityToken.MAX_ENDORSEMENTS();
+        for (uint256 i = 0; i < maxEndorsements; i++) {
             vm.prank(alice);
             identityToken.endorse(aliceId, bobId, keccak256(abi.encodePacked("Connection", i)), 0);
         }

         vm.prank(alice);
         vm.expectRevert(Errors.IndexOutOfBounds.selector);
-        identityToken.endorse(aliceId, bobId, keccak256(abi.encodePacked("Connection", uint256(100))), 0);
+        identityToken.endorse(
+            aliceId,
+            bobId,
+            keccak256(abi.encodePacked("Connection", maxEndorsements)),
+            0
+        );
